Call 112 in Poland for an immediate threat to life, serious injury, fire or suspected severe poisoning. The operator sends the appropriate emergency service.
Poland has regional toxicology information and treatment centres rather than one universal public poison hotline. Emergency teams and hospitals contact the appropriate centre. Do not induce vomiting unless instructed; keep the package or chemical label and report the substance, amount, time, age and symptoms.
For a person who is unconscious, convulsing, struggling to breathe or rapidly worsening, call 112 immediately. A pharmacy can help with non-urgent medicine questions but cannot replace emergency assessment.
